Transaction d77a114eb99333a3dc6196cc6d0af8b24c59649ee13da6ed59a1674c9c02ed74
1 Input
1 Output
-
d77a114eb99333a3dc6196cc6d0af8b24c59649ee13da6ed59a1674c9c02ed74:0
- value
- 768002
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e5100774b42b09efd426c8cb4276d804131a8f4
- address
- bc1q3egsqa6tg2cfal2zdjxtgfmdspqnr285q64rmy